Layering sublimation transitions of the spin-1 Blume–Emery–Griffiths model in a transverse field

A. Benyoussef, H. Ez-Zahraouy, H. Mahboub and M.J. Ouazzani

Physica A: Statistical Mechanics and its Applications, 2003, vol. 326, issue 1, 220-232

Abstract: The effect of the transverse field Ω on bulk melting and layering sublimation transitions of a spin-1 Blume–Emery–Griffiths (BEG) model is studied using the mean field theory. It is found that there exists a critical value of the transverse field Ωl above which a sequence of layering sublimation occurs before melting bulk transition.
